The Power of Nutrition: How Instacart and 9amHealth are Using Food to Fight Chronic Disease

Nutrition and health are connected - what people eat can be a powerful tool for disease prevention or a contributor to the development of chronic, diet-related illness. With Instacart Health, we're on a mission to ensure everyone has access to the nourishment they need to live a healthy life. We believe in the power of using food as a tool to improve health and well-being, and through our new partnership with 9amHealth, we're offering 9amHealth's patients easy and affordable access to nutritious food through their diabetes, weight, and heart health programs.

Improving health through nutrition is a win-win for both patients and the healthcare system as a whole. Studies have shown that if people's diets improved, there could be more than $100 billion in savings for patients, taxpayers, providers, and insurers - including both employer-funded health plans and government programs like Medicare and Medicaid.

As treatments like GLP-1 drugs gain popularity, experts recognize their effectiveness in managing diabetes and obesity, but caution that they aren't a cure-all for chronic disease management. As use-cases expand, it's estimated that roughly 9% of Americans could be using a GLP-1 medication by 2030. The Food is Medicine Institute at Tufts University recently highlighted in educational briefings to Congress that while GLP-1 drugs help with weight loss, sustained improvements in body weight health depend on long-term dietary and behavioral habits. These changes are essential for achieving better health outcomes, promoting health equity and reducing overall care costs.

Our partnership with 9amHealth is designed to ensure that nutrition remains a key focus in chronic disease treatment, management, and prevention. 9amHealth offers care plans that give members access to a team of specialists, including dietitians, who curate meal plans and provide education based on each person's health conditions. Our partnership integrates Instacart Health Fresh Funds into their care model to expand access to nutritious foods. By encouraging dietary and lifestyle changes, paired with convenient food delivery, we have the opportunity to reduce the total cost of care while improving health outcomes. And for those who are on medication regimens that require specific diets - like GLP-1s - our tools are well-suited to help them follow their providers' guidance and cement long-term behavioral changes.

Instacart Health products are dynamic and flexible, and can be used to support patients through every stage of their health journey. We're giving patients the tools they need - from nutrition information and recipe inspiration to meal planning and convenient ordering - to take action and, ultimately, lead a healthier life.
